means A device or enclosure that rains water down on you for washing, or the act of getting clean under it — and by extension a brief fall of rain or a party where gifts pour onto the guest of honor.
from From Old English 'scūr,' meaning a brief fall of rain, hail, or even arrows — anything that comes down in a sudden burst. It has cousins across the Germanic family (German 'Schauer'). The bathing fixture is a much later twist: the 'shower bath' arrived only in the 19th century, borrowing the idea of falling water. The gift-giving 'baby shower' or 'bridal shower' is later still, an early-20th-century American notion of presents raining down on the lucky recipient.
